     Established in August 1997, CTTA's mission is to promote the sport of tennis and to give the youth in the inner city of Austin, particularly in East Austin, the opportunity to participate in a sport they would not otherwise be exposed, while making it more affordable for all. 
     Today, CTTA not only provides tennis clinics to kids, adults, and seniors but mentoring/tutoring, science/math/reading clubs, computer skills, and social needs to thousands in Austin and surrounding communities.

27th Annual CATA Junior Awards

​    On Sunday, May 1, 2022, Capital Area      Tennis Association (CATA) held its 27th       Annual Junior Awards Banquet at the   
  Renaissance Hotel in Austin, Texas.   
  Several clubs and facilities were   
  recognized for their programming for   
​  junior players in the Capital Area. 
    Congratulations Victoria Ramon as the
  2022 Most Valuable Female Player
  and Evan Hamilton as the 2022 Most   
  Valuable Male Player for Central Texas
​  Tennis Association (CTTA).
